Job Summary

The Analyst, Finance – Fixed Assets is responsible for controlling, recording, and maintaining fixed asset transactions to ensure accurate financial records and asset locations. This position supports fixed asset activities for Mexico and U.S. operations, including depreciation, capitalization, construction in progress (CIP), asset transfers and disposals, capital forecasting, and capital project tracking.

The role partners with Finance and operational teams to ensure compliance with fixed asset procedures, internal controls, and applicable policies. The Analyst will also support month-end closing activities, audits, capital expenditure processes, and continuous improvement init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Manage and maintain accurate fixed asset records for Mexico and U.S. operations.
  • Ensure proper accounting treatment and calculation of fixed asset depreciation.
  • Coordinate the receipt, documentation, photographs, identification, and physical location of fixed assets.
  • Review and provide required information for Capital Appropriation Requests (CARs) and support the approval process.
  • Ensure compliance with established fixed asset policies, procedures, and internal controls.
  • Prepare capital forecasts and monitor capital projects, including approvals, payments, expenditures, and budget execution.
  • Perform capitalization activities and maintain appropriate control of Construction in Progress (CIP) for Mexico and U.S. operations.
  • Process and maintain appropriate documentation for fixed asset transfers, disposals, and other asset movements.
  • Support the administration and control of asset movement and exit documentation.
  • Assist with month-end and financial closing activities related to fixed assets.
  • Provide documentation and support for internal and external audits.
  • Partner with cross-functional and local teams to ensure fixed asset information is complete, accurate, and timely.
  • Support continuous improvement and operational excellence initiatives.
  • Maintain compliance with Cardinal Health policies, Quality System requirements, Ethics standards, and applicable EHS procedures.
